德国多孔隙石质古迹化学增强保护新材料和新施工工艺 被引量:8

Introduction to new Chemicals and techniques for stone preservation

摘要 介绍了20世纪90年代德国石质古迹化学增强保护的新材料和新的施工工艺。提出呈皮壳状风化石雕保护的建议。 In the context of preserving natural stone, it is often necessary to consolidate the structure by applying a stone strengthener. Materials based on silicic acid esters have been used for decades throughout the world. In this paper, the chemical mechanism, application limits of stone strengthener based on classic silicic acid ester has been discussed. New developments, so called elastified silicic acid ester has been introduced, developed as a product system to extend what is feasible. The elastified silicic acid ester system is opening new possibility to solve most of damages occurred in stone monuments.
